William Henry Holmes: a Pioneer of American Art
William Henry Holmes, active in the late 19th century, is recognized for his role in the development of American landscape art. Influenced by the Impressionist movement, he captured the beauty of natural landscapes with a unique approach. Holmes was also an influential member of the American Watercolor Society, helping to popularize watercolor as an artistic medium. His work reflects the concerns of his time, notably the preservation of nature in the face of increasing industrialization. As an artist, he skillfully combined technique and emotion, making his landscapes witnesses to American history.
